Bangladesh High Commissioner Interacts with Indian Armed Forces’ Future Leader

By Pratham Gurung
Last updated: February 27, 2024
Share
Bangaldeshi high commissioner

Mr. Mustafizur Rahman, the esteemed High Commissioner of Bangladesh to India, recently delivered a compelling lecture on โ€œRegional Security Landscape & Opportunities and Challenges for Bilateral Relationsโ€ to the Future Leaders of the Indian Armed Forces.

The lecture took place during the Tri-services Joint Capsule at the prestigious Army War College (AWC) in Mhow, Madhya Pradesh.

In his enlightening address, High Commissioner Rahman provided invaluable insights into the evolving regional security dynamics and the myriad opportunities and challenges that shape bilateral relations between India and Bangladesh.

His talk shed light on crucial aspects concerning mutual security concerns, diplomatic cooperation, and avenues for enhancing bilateral ties between the two nations.

Interacting with Lt Gen DP Pandey, the distinguished Commandant of AWC, Mr. Rahman conveyed his sincere appreciation for the institutionโ€™s commitment to excellence in training, pedagogy, and infrastructure development.

He commended the AWC for its unwavering dedication to providing high-quality training to future leaders of the Indian Armed Forces, recognizing the pivotal role it plays in shaping the strategic thinking and operational readiness of military personnel.

The dialogue between Mr. Rahman and the Future Leaders of the Indian Armed Forces serves as a testament to the enduring partnership and mutual respect shared between India and Bangladesh. It underscores the importance of robust diplomatic engagement and strategic collaboration in addressing shared security challenges and fostering regional stability.

The insightful discourse offered by the Bangladesh High Commissioner provided a valuable platform for exchange and dialogue, enabling participants to gain a deeper understanding of the complex security landscape and the opportunities for cooperation between the two neighboring countries.

It emphasized the importance of building trust, fostering dialogue, and forging partnerships to address common security concerns and promote peace and prosperity in the region.

As the Indian Armed Forces continue to navigate the complexities of the contemporary security environment, engagements such as these play a pivotal role in enhancing their strategic awareness, fostering cross-border cooperation, and promoting enduring friendships with neighboring nations like Bangladesh.

The lecture delivered by Mr. Mustafizur Rahman serves as a testament to the shared commitment of India and Bangladesh to strengthening bilateral relations and advancing regional security cooperation for the collective benefit of both nations.
